Description

Problem:

When reviewing code issues in Amazon Q, clicking or using arrow keys to select an issue does not:

  • Focus the code editor on the relevant line
  • Display the issue details/description

Solution:

  • Added TreeSelectionListener in codeScanTree to detect selection of an issue
  • Removed Redundant MouseListener Logic since click would automatically invoke selection
